Irmo Little League went 2-0 in winning the South Carolina District 3 Coaches Pitch softball tournament this past weekend. County Councilman Jason Branham (District 1) presented a proclamation to the Irmo Little League February 4 honoring the organization’s winning year. By Thomas Grant, Jr. The Irmo Little League Majors continued their “victory tour” this past week with a special visit to the South Carolina Statehouse, where they were guests of Governor Henry McMaster. Irmo Little League is writing one of the most remarkable stories ever seen in Williamsport. By Thomas Grant, Jr. WILLIAMSPORT, Pa. — For the second time in the post-season, Irmo Little League Majors avoided elimination with a final inning comeback.
